Since 2010, Goldfields has forged a reputation for delivering distinctive projects by combining sophisticated environments with refined aesthetics.We’ve quickly grown to be a national, diversified Australian property developer and currently have a project pipeline of $3.5 billion across multiple asset classes and states.Our team have a wealth of experience across residential apartments, townhouses, master-planned land communities, hotels, mixed-use projects and commercial developments. We work with some of Australia’s leading architects, designers and builders to bring an unparalleled vision and expertise to each development.
